Crab Apple (Malus Sylvestris)
A gorgeous addition to a native mixed hedge with its cup shaped pink flowers emerging from red buds in spring and crab apples for jelly (if the birds and squirrels leave any) after the first frost in autumn. Crab apples flower from March to May with pink buds and white blossom flushed with pink much sought after by bees. The fruit looks like miniature apples and is yellow/green tinged with red. Although very sour when raw, the crab apples have a high pectin content which makes them ideal for jelly making - or apple juice when blended with less astringent apple varieties. Pick after frost. Crab apple is the 3rd most mentioned species used for boundary hedging in Angle Saxon times and it supports 90 different species of insect and birds.

It is native (ex Scotland and Ireland), deciduous, hardy and does best in sun or partial shade. It will tolerate dry and exposed sites. Crab Apple can be "hedged" or allowed to grow as a tree.

Planting distances are very much a matter of choice - for bare roots, 3 plants per metre is adequate, 5 is good, 7 in a double staggered row will give a dense hedge quicker. Generally, smaller plants should be planted at higher density. Cell grown should be planted at 4 per metre in a single row or ideally 6 per metre in a staggered row.
